  3. This is the discography of English singer and songwriter Ella Eyre. Her debut studio album, Feline, was released in August 2015. It peaked at number 4 on the UK Albums Chart. The album includes the singles "Deeper", "If I Go", "Comeback", "Together" and "Good Times".
